The Global Specialty Super Absorbent Polymer Market is currently valued at approximately USD 9.00 billion in 2024 and is projected to expand at a robust CAGR of 9.40% over the forecast period from 2025 to 2035. Specialty super absorbent polymers (SAPs), known for their ability to absorb and retain large volumes of liquid relative to their mass, have revolutionized applications across various sectors, particularly in personal hygiene and agriculture. These polymers-primarily composed of sodium polyacrylate or copolymers of polyacrylate/polyacrylamide-are becoming indispensable due to their superior water retention capacity and versatility in formulation. As global awareness grows around hygiene standards, especially post-pandemic, the integration of SAPs in diapers, sanitary napkins, and adult incontinence products has surged dramatically. In parallel, the agriculture industry is capitalizing on SAPs for moisture control in drought-prone areas, enhancing crop resilience and productivity.

The market's momentum is being significantly reinforced by rising demands in developing nations, where improving living standards are increasing the consumption of hygiene products. Furthermore, advancements in bio-based SAPs are catering to the sustainability mandates from both consumers and regulatory bodies. With personal hygiene products transitioning towards more skin-friendly and biodegradable components, SAP manufacturers are innovating high-performance materials with reduced environmental impact. Simultaneously, ongoing R&D efforts are working to optimize SAP performance under saline and alkaline conditions-key to expanding their scope across horticulture, medical waste control, and even flood mitigation.

Regionally, North America commands a major stake in the global specialty SAP market, primarily due to its mature personal care industry and sophisticated agricultural practices. The U.S., in particular, continues to be a hub for innovation in polymer science and holds a dense concentration of global SAP manufacturers. Europe follows closely, driven by strong consumer demand for sustainable products and stringent regulations promoting environmentally friendly alternatives. Meanwhile, the Asia Pacific region is poised to experience the fastest growth during the forecast period, with countries such as China and India investing heavily in water-saving technologies in agriculture and witnessing exponential growth in hygiene-related consumption. Growing birth rates, increased awareness around sanitation, and government-led hygiene initiatives are nurturing a thriving landscape for specialty SAPs in the region.
